Arsenal’s away jersey for the 2021/22 campaign has been released by Footy Headlines. The jersey is inspired by the club’s many away jerseys between the 1970s and 1990s. It also includes the return of the historic cannon to the left of the chest. Arsenal’s 2021/22 jersey will be produced by Adidas, with whom they announced a five-year kit deal until 2024. The Gunners are pocketing an astonishing £65 million per year, which started from the 2019/20 season. Have a look at Arsenal’s both home and away jerseys for the next campaign. Leaked image of Arsenal’s home kit for the 2021/22 season. The home kit will be ‘scarlet’, also used for the Arsenal 2018/19 home kit. Leeds United returned to winning ways after beating Fulham 2-1 at Craven Cottage in the Premier League on Friday night. The Whites recorded their first win in London since 2017 and many Leeds fans are drooling over Kalvin Phillips for his outstanding individual display. Patrick Bamford scored one and provided the other for Raphinha as Leeds picked up all three points to move above Crystal Palace in 11th. Bamford, who unfortunately missed out on a call-up to the latest England squad, opened the scoring with a superb low finish. Joachim Andersen restored parity before the break, but Leeds scored again in the 58th minute through Brazilian winger, Raphinha. Arsenal attacker Emile Smith Rowe has talked about the influence of Alexandre Lacazette on some of the younger players at the club. The 20-year-old made his first Premier League appearance of the season on Boxing Day against Chelsea and he has since been a regular starter when fit. The youngster has four assists in his 13 league games and his reputation has improved on a game-by-game basis with the Gunners. In an exclusive interview with The Sun, Smith Rowe spoke about the influence that Lacazette has had on him since he became a regular. The former Hale End graduate said that the Frenchman has helped him so much and gives confidence to the young players by praising their qualities. According to reports from The Telegraph, Jose Mourinho is fighting an uphill battle to keep his Tottenham Hotspur job past this season. After Tottenham’s disappointing Europa League exit, his position at the club has once again come under threat. It has been claimed that even success in the final of next month’s Carabao Cup final will not guarantee his safety. The 3-0 defeat against Dinamo Zagreb was a crushing blow to Mourinho’s hopes of surviving the threat of the sack. The report claims that players are divided over Mourinho’s training methods. Mourinho retains the support of some of Tottenham’s key players, but there are others who have questioned his training methods and his handling of various situations. BBC football expert Mark Lawrenson has stated his prediction for the Premier League clash between West Ham United and Arsenal this weekend. The Hammers recently suffered a 1-0 league defeat at Manchester United, but they are still within three points of fourth-placed Chelsea with a game in hand. David Moyes’ side are scheduled to host the Gunners on Sunday, and Lawrenson feels the club will be determined to avoid a second-straight defeat. The Gunners are currently seven points behind the Hammers in the 10th spot, but they are unbeaten in the last three games in the top-flight (two wins and one draw). Newcastle United take on Brighton and Hove Albion in the Premier League tomorrow, and the Magpies are under pressure to pick up all three points. Steve Bruce’s team have failed to win their last five league matches and are in danger of losing their top-flight status. The Magpies have failed to score in six of their last eight away league games and are missing key attackers like Callum Wilson and Allan Saint-Maximin for this fixture. The visitors will need a bit of luck the score against a well-organised Brighton defence, especially without their top forwards. Brighton have an impressive record against Newcastle, keeping a clean sheet in six of their last seven matches against the Magpies in all competitions. Marcelo Bielsa has dropped a hint that he may not look to sign a new striker in the summer transfer window. Leeds United have been heavily reliant on Patrick Bamford, and there are suggestions that Bielsa should look to add more quality in the forward department. However, the Argentine claims that he is happy with the attacking force he has got at the moment and has played down Leeds’ need to sign a new striker. The fixtures for the Champions League quarter-finals have been drawn, with several enticing fixtures. Manchester City were the first side out of the pot, coming up against Borussia Dortmund, while Porto got drawn against Chelsea. The final two fixtures see repeats of recent finals, with Bayern Munich facing Paris Saint-Germain, and Real Madrid playing Liverpool.
